Output f84665b10c24943a1ea0f229ac07ff1588df25369668e11bd71f9fd77f00b0f7:0

value
1837812372
script pubkey
OP_0 OP_PUSHBYTES_20 50f23bab1c8adc11960e9ee2bed1b4529543ef26
address
bc1q2rerh2cu3twpr9swnm3ta5d522258mexazj3mw
transaction
f84665b10c24943a1ea0f229ac07ff1588df25369668e11bd71f9fd77f00b0f7
spent
true